Quote:
Originally Posted by Vypurr View Post
Keep working...The best pictures are usually a result of Post-Processing though. Atleast until you become a pro.
Post processing can add to a picture but good pictures are proper exposure, good composition, and a good subject matter. Post processing doesn't help composition and subject it may aid exposure but nothing else. And don't forget proper focus.
